Fencing (4th-9th Grade)
Ages: 9 - 15
Step into the exciting world of swishes, lunges, and lightning‑fast moves. In this beginner‑friendly camp, young fencers will explore the art and history of fencing while learning real skills used by competitive athletes. Campers will practice footwork, blade work, conditioning drills, and basic tactics — all in a fun, supportive environment designed for absolute beginners.
By the end of the week, students will be able to step onto the strip and fence a full bout with confidence. It’s active, empowering, and the perfect blend of strategy, movement, and adventure for any camper ready to try something new.

Pickleball (5th-10th Grade)
Ages: 9 - 17
This camp is the perfect blend of fast-paced fun, friendly competition, and skill-building for players of all experience levels. Campers will learn the fundamentals of this wildly popular sport—including serving, volleys, footwork, strategy, and court etiquette—through upbeat drills and engaging games that keep everyone moving.
Each day features a mix of instruction, practice matches, and team challenges designed to build confidence and improve coordination. Campers will develop strong sportsmanship, sharpen their reflexes, and discover just how exciting pickleball can be. Whether they’re brand new to the game or already obsessed, this camp offers a supportive environment where every player can grow.
